What are the tax consequences of investing in cryptocurrencies?

One important consideration is that the IRS treats cryptocurrencies as property, not currency. This means that any gains or losses from cryptocurrency investments are subject to capital gains tax. If you sell your cryptocurrencies for a profit, you will need to report the capital gains on your tax return and pay taxes on the amount. On the other hand, if you sell your cryptocurrencies at a loss, you may be able to deduct the losses from your taxable income. It's important to keep track of your transactions and calculate your gains or losses accurately to ensure compliance with tax laws.

The tax implications can vary depending on factors such as the country you reside in and the specific regulations in place. In some cases, you may be required to report your cryptocurrency holdings and transactions, even if you haven't sold them. Additionally, if you receive cryptocurrencies as payment for goods or services, you will need to report the fair market value of the received cryptocurrencies as income. It's always a good idea to keep detailed records of your cryptocurrency activities to make the tax filing process smoother and avoid any potential issues with the tax authorities.
